### TrimBot API: Authentication

TrimBot, the stale-branch cleanup bot, scans repositories nightly and opens deletion proposals for branches with no commits in ninety days and no open merge requests. Reviewers interacting with the proposal endpoints — approving, deferring, or exempting a branch — must authenticate every request, since exemptions are audited and attributed. Requests without credentials are rejected with a 401 and logged. All calls to the TrimBot review API authenticate using the key below.

gateway credential: kto7_GoY89Me

Welcome aboard! As noted in your onboarding doc, the WaveTrace service renders audio waveform previews for the Larkspur media library. Right now staging returns blank previews because the environment was copied from a developer laptop and is missing the render-cache credential. Please SSH to the staging box, open /etc/wavetrace/preview.env, and confirm SAMPLE_RATE=44100 and CACHE_TTL=3600 are present. Once those check out, add the render-cache secret on the line immediately after CACHE_TTL.

env line for yahip-tafog: RELAY_SECRET3=4ca

Escalate any anomaly on the Harrowfield telemetry gateway—unexpected device enrollments, certificate mismatches, or sustained ingestion failures—to the gateway on-call within fifteen minutes of detection. Preserve the raw packet captures and the enrollment audit log before restarting any service. Second-tier escalation goes to the Tillhouse platform security group. For coordination on incident reports, contact the gateway security lead.

escalation mailbox, kadup-fajof: ulador@qirvanlabs.corp

BRIEFING — Leadership Review: Franchise Agreement

For heads of department. Legal has completed its second pass on the proposed franchise agreement with Orvane Hospitality Group covering the Lakemont and Dresser Valley territories. Key terms: ten-year term, royalty at five and a half percent, mandatory refit within eighteen months. Outstanding issues are the exclusivity radius and the training cost split. Department input is requested by end of next week. Strategic context follows in the confidential note below.

management briefing: Casvanek Logistics plans to lower the Druox list price by 49.1 percent in April. The board signed off on a budget of $16.5 million for Project Rusath. The renewal with Kasvanix Partners closes at $67.9 million a year, 33.9 percent above the last contract. Project Casath slips by one quarter because of the staffing delay.